Kubernetes: A simple overview

O'Reilly Media - Ideas

Kubernetes allows DevOps teams to automate container provisioning, networking, load balancing, security, and scaling across a cluster, says Sébastien Goasguen in his Kubernetes Fundamentals training course. Containerizing an application and its dependencies helps abstract it from an operating system and infrastructure.
